Why it's worth checking out
Galatea Point sits at Kew, near Collingwood in Melbourne's inner east, along the Yarra River. With 36 reviews behind its 4.5 rating, it's a much-loved spot.
The appeal is a lovely slice of riverside nature — a point along the Yarra with lovely water and bushland surrounds, a genuine favourite for a walk, a pause and connecting with nature close to the city. It's a lovely, free outing.
Riverside spots and trails have changing conditions and seasonal considerations, so check current details before you go. Otherwise it's a free spot to enjoy whenever the weather's good — bring water, sun protection and comfortable shoes.
